Impact of trichothecenes on <i>Fusarium</i> head blight [ <i>Fusarium graminearum</i> ] development in spring wheat ( <i>Triticum aestivum</i> )

>Fusarium head blight pathogens (Fusarium spp.) produce trichothecenes that have been demonstrated to play a role in the pathogenesis. To test the impact of trichothecenes on a broad range of genotypes, 18 spring wheat lines (Triticum aestivum) were inoculated with two Fusarium graminearum strains, the genetically modified GzT40 strain, which could not produce trichothecene, and the wild parental Gz3639 strain. During 3 weeks of observation, the two fungal strains showed extreme differences in aggressiveness in all but three of wheat genotypes tested. While the GzT40 mutant did not spread into the rachis, the wild-type strain quickly spread in the spike. This work confirms earlier findings that trichothecenes are a principal determinant of F. graminearum aggressiveness on most spring wheat cultivars. Therefore, trichothecenes may serve as a useful screening tool in programs breeding for resistance to Fusarium head blight of wheat.Key words: trichothecenes, deoxynivalenol, mycotoxins, Fusarium head blight, Fusarium graminearum, spring wheat, Triticum aestivum.
